First of all, as always, it is necessary to remove the battery, then unscrew all the visible bolts of 16pcs large (marked in red) and five pieces of small ones (marked by green)

Next, it is necessary to remove the cover of the hard drive compartment, RAM and the Wi-Fi module in the lower part of the case, a few more large bolts are found under it (marked in red, it should be noted that two of them have a noticeably lower length, and also differ in color). You should also immediately pull out the Wi-Fi module (marked with green).

Having turned the laptop, the most interesting begins, since the process of removing the upper cover in this model is noticeably different from most models presented on the market. The top cover of the laptop is divided into two functional parts, part with a touchpad and the keyboard. Part with a touchpad is removed, like most by a sharp object in the area of ​​the touchpad itself (it is difficult to lie and there is a feeling that something is about to break).

The keyboard part is easier, it is only necessary to dissect it with a sharp object with the lower part of the case around the perimeter.

Throwing back the touchparish part and cleansing the keyboard, you can turn off the loop of their retaining. 1) Putting buttons 2) Tachpad train3) keyboard trail

Turning off the loops and removing the upper parts to the side, we see an internally laptop device. To remove the motherboard, it is necessary to twist two bolts (marked in red) and turn off the following connectors.

1) and 4) connectors of the left and right built.in speakers2) the matrix connector3) the microphone connector4) the train of additional USB

Having done the above operations and turning over the motherboard, you also need to turn off the charger connector.

Having pulled out the motherboard on the table, you can start dismantling the cooling system. In this model, as with some others, the principle of separate CO (t.e cooler can be removed separately from the radiator). To remove the cooler, you just need to unscrew three bolts (marked by green), it is worth noting that the cooler in this model is not collapsible and it will not work to lubricate it. To remove the radiator C, it is necessary to unscrew four spring.loaded bolts (on the processor) and two ordinary (on the video chip).

Having removed the cooler, you can fully clean the radiator from dust and wool, after that the radiator is not available with special need, but for a full view I decided to remove it and it turned out to be not in vain.

After complete dismantling with me, a picture of the unscrupulous work of the previous masters appeared, but not the complete removal of the old thermal paste before applying a new one (the photo is poorly visible, but the white paste has an adherence to the old gray, which is unacceptable)

After the thorough removal of all traces of thermal paste from the soles of the radiator (marked with green) and from the crystals of the chips (marked with red) and applying the new thermal paste layer, you can slowly start assembling the laptop in the reverse sequence (be sure to check all the connectors to their places).

How to disassemble the Packard Bell BG45 laptop

Sometimes it may be necessary to make out your laptop. For example, to clean it from dust and dirt, to replace RAM or a hard disk, for lubricating the cooling cooler or replacing the thermal paste of the central processor. In this article we will consider the procedure for disassembling the laptop Packard Bell BG45.

First of all, turn off the BG45 laptop from the power supply and take out the battery. Then we unscrew all the screws on the lower surface of the laptop. Fold the screws in some container so as not to lose.

Remove two covers from the bottom of the case. The smaller of the covers closes the compartment of the hard disk and wireless Wi-Fi adapter, and the large compartment, which contains RAM and central processor with the cooling system.

Removing the covers from the lower part of the laptop BG45

We take out a hard drive. It is attached in special sledges. To take it out, you need to pull the flexible tongue in the direction from the connector.

We take out the cooler (cooling fan), which is fixed with screws and glued with a sticky tape to the radiator. Unscrewing the screws and peeling off the tape, it is easily removed.

It was the turn of the keyboard dismantling. We turn the BG45 laptop with a keyboard to ourselves.

To remove the keyboard, you need to gently lift it and raise it from the side that is closer to the laptop display. The keyboard is fixed with plastic latches along all this side. Therefore, be careful not to damage them when removing the keyboard. When the latches are weakened, raise the keyboard slightly by pulling. Carefully disconnect the plugs connecting the keyboard with the motherboard of the laptop BG45.

The upper cover of the Packard Bell BG45 laptop (on which the touchpad is located, the inclusion button and the LED indicators of the wireless network and the hard disk) is connected to the motherboard with several loops. Disconnect all the loops and remove the top cover.

Removing the top cover of the laptop BG45 Removing the top cover of the laptop bg45

Now let’s go along the perimeter of the upper cover with a plastic screwdriver or other tool (not metal so as not to damage the case) and reveal all the latches. After that, the top cover of the laptop can be removed.

We have become completely available to the Maternal Pack of the Packard Bell BG45 laptop. The laptop is disassembled.

How to disassemble the laptop Packard Bell Dot S

The disassembly of this laptop begins as always by extracting the battery. We turn the laptop and move the capture of the compartment where the battery is openly. To remove the battery, you need to push the latch to the side and hold it while you take out the battery.

It will not be much superfluous to get rid of the memory cards. Tenderly pressing it, release the plug and pull it out. This simple procedure is shown in the pictures below.

The next step is to extract RAM. It is located under the lid, not quite correct shape. Unscrew it and open it.

We begin the procedure for removing memory planks. Bending special latches that hold the bar, we take them out. Below there is a detailed photo of this process.

The next step in disassembling the laptop, this remove the cover from the compartment where a hard drive is installed, followed by the seizure of the disk itself. The procedure is not complicated, but if anyone has doubts, we look at the photo below, everything is clear there.

There are also two modules under this lid, which also need to be removed. This is a 3G module and Wlan wireless module. We disconnect the wires that are antennas, first from the Wlan module. Remember what kind of wire went where. Unscrew one screw that holds this module, and remove the module as shown in the picture. Nothing complicated.

We start extracting the 3G module. There is no point in commenting on a lot of commenting on. The process is similar to the process of extracting the WLAN module. Turn off the antennas, unscrew the screws, pull out the 3G board. In the photo, this process is captured in detail.

Remove the keyboard of the laptop Packard Bell Dot S. Find the latch that holds the keyboard. It is located on top of the keyboard, strictly in the middle. Click on the latch and push the keyboard. Raise the left and then the right corner of the keyboard in turn to separate the latch below. The keyboard should be freed. But do not pull it, it is connected by a train with a laptop.

How to disassemble the Packard Bell Easynote LJ75 laptop

Let’s begin to disassemble this miracle with the fact that we will turn it on and put it on the top cover. Remote the battery and unscrew several screws attaching the compartments cover where the hard drives stand and where the RAM is located. Hard drives on this laptop model already as many as two.

After removing the lids, pull out hard drives from the laptop.

Unscrew all the screws that are shown in the photo above. These screws hold the upper and lower housing cover, as well as the matrix and overlay above the keyboard. We pull out the RAM, carefully bending the latches holding it.

We take out the optical drive. To do this, unscrew the screws, as shown in the picture, the lower drive and extract it. It may turn out that the drive will go tight. Without forcing events, you can help him with a screwdriver by pushing him. The process is imprinted in the photo.

With DVD the drive finished. Put it on the side and forget about him for a while. Let’s take care of the wi-fi module with removing. The board is on only one screw. Having unhooked the wires going to the antenna and unscrewing this same screw, we extract this module.

With the lower part of the laptop we figured out. It should turn out such a “lightweight” version of the Packard Bell Easynote LJ75 laptop, as shown in the picture.

It is time to take up the disassembly of the upper part of the laptop. I propose to start from the panel above the keyboard. Gently picing it from the left edge, as shown in the figure, then we follow the latches located behind, under the LCD monitor. This is shown in the photo.

Now from left to right we try to raise the pad. Without applying any destructive methods. We raise the pad on ourselves and find a train under it, leading to the touch buttons located on the panel itself. Turn off this train and the panel is released.

The keyboard is removed not in a tricky way. Putting her with your fingers from the right edge, then from the left edge, we move it over and see the Swing connecting the laptop with the keyboard. Turn off this train and on this the keyboard is completed.

Now our laptop with a keyboard removed like this looks like this.

We dissolve the connector going into the power button. Then we take out all the wires from the highways.

Do not forget to turn off the large connector going to the laptop display, as well as the connector, which, in my opinion, goes to the webcam. We free the wires.

How to disassemble the Packard Bell Easynote TM89 laptop

We start as always by the fact that before disassembling the laptop we de.energize it and turn it off.

You need to remove the battery. Moving the capture of the compartment in which the battery is located in an open position, we move the lock and take out the battery.

This laptop has a built-in SIM card. It is inserted and taken out through the battery compartment. Light pressing on the card, we seek its extension from the slot. Then we just take the map and pull out. She for some time, while we are doing the disassembly of the laptop, is no longer needed.

We do similar actions with a slope of the slot for reading memory cards. Click on it, it moves forward, take it and extract. Extremely simple task.

The next step will be the extraction of an optical drive. Up the only one screw, we take it out.

The DVD drive procedure is completed. Remove the lower lid of the laptop under which they hide: Winchester, wireless module and RAM. By unscrewing the three screws, we bend the lid, as shown in the figure and now we have the opportunity to get to the desired elements of the laptop in order to remove them.

In this laptop Packard Bell Easynote TM89 there is also a 3G module, which we also immediately remove. The process in all details is visible in the photo below.

Disconnect all the wires leading to this 3G module, and unscrew the screw fastening it. We extract the module.

Let’s go back to the non-completed procedure for the seizure of the hard drive, Wi-Fi board and RAM. We start with memory. How to take out the laptop’s RAM I think no one needs to tell anyone. If there are people who are a novelty, I will explain briefly. We bend the latches holding the memory planks, then pull out the strips from the slot. Nothing complicated.

Start turning off and extracting a wireless module. Everything is like with a 3G module here. Turn off the wires from it, not forgetting to notice what went where. We unscrew the screw and take out the module.
